Output 10058cb0ca11ac68fc6b9e797144b64a609c18ba7ac97e16d52e62993ff6c0b2:4

value
1582300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f96ae74c0c251bc32697e5114e62e4b6171d995 OP_EQUAL
address
3Bs3SNMNM6Q5D1PDpZ47jS7jUc93FdEWsn
transaction
10058cb0ca11ac68fc6b9e797144b64a609c18ba7ac97e16d52e62993ff6c0b2
confirmations
302448
spent
true